Jordan agrees to import gas from Israel

The Jordanian government yesterday signed an agreement to import gas from Israel, a statement by the country’s national power company revealed.

Jordan’s National Electric Power Company Ltd (NEPCO), which represents the government, signed the agreement with the Mediterranean basin-developing company, Noble Energy,

According to a statement issued by NEPCO, under the terms of the agreement, Jordan with receive 40 per cent of its electricity-generating needs.

According to NEPCO statement, the deal will enhance regional cooperation and allow Jordan to utilise gas field discoveries in the Mediterranean to build a gas network with lines to export gas from these discoveries and link them to Europe.

Noble Energy owns 39 per cent of the Leviathan natural gas field in Israel.
